Batley is a town in West Yorkshire, England, with a population of around 39,013. It has 68 bus stops, 1 GP & clinic, 4 pharmacies, 1 supermarket, and 24 restaurants and cafés, with the nearest railway station being Batley, 1.3 km away. The average sold house price is around £213,062, and there were around 520 recorded street crimes in June 2026, most commonly violence & sexual offences. This page gathers weather, crime, food hygiene, transport, flood risk, house prices, population, deprivation and your local MP for the Batley area — all from official UK open data.

On deprivation, the Kirklees area is more deprived than the average in England (IoD2019). The wider council area has around 433,216 residents at roughly 1,060 people per km².

Notable places nearby

  • Batley Carr · 0.1 km

    Batley Carr is a district which includes parts of Dewsbury and Batley in West Yorkshire, England.

  • Staincliffe and Batley Carr railway station · 0.4 km

    Staincliffe and Batley Carr railway station served the hamlet of Staincliffe and the district of Batley Carr in West Yorkshire, England from 1878 to 1952 on the Huddersfield Line.
